Organization and Position Overview

The Area Engineer will serve as the site subject matter expert (SME) for the Logistics Buildings, Tank Farm, and associated ancillary systems within the Facilities, Utilities, Maintenance & Engineering (FUME) organization. During the project phase, this role will be a key member of the cross‑functional project team, supporting design, construction, commissioning, qualification, start‑up, and operational readiness for systems associated with the Lilly Medicine Foundry’s logistics buildings and tank farm. Once in operation, the Area Engineer will be responsible for ensuring these systems are maintained in a compliant, reliable, cost‑effective, and fit‑for‑use state to meet business and internal customer needs. This role will also drive continuous improvement initiatives, manage annual operating and capital expenditures, and serve as the single point of contact for residents and customers associated with the logistics buildings and tank farm.

Responsibilities
  • Serve as the SME with deep technical expertise for assigned systems, including their applications in pharmaceutical manufacturing and support operations, process flow diagrams, key process parameters, and relevant industry trends.
  • Support risk assessment activities using available tools, such as Failure Mode and Effects Analysis (FMEA).
  • Participate in teams, committees, or individual efforts as needed to support FUME departmental, site, and company goals.
  • Lead or participate in projects and changes for systems within the logistics buildings and tank farm, including design, verification activities (IV/OV/PQ), user representation for capital projects, and delivery of local projects.
  • Develop required documentation, such as User Requirements Specifications (URS) and test cases, to demonstrate that systems are properly installed, qualified, started up, and maintained in a state of control.
  • Develop standard operating procedures (SOPs) and other necessary documentation for assigned systems.
  • Contribute to process resource assessments, capital plans, expense budgets, and prioritization activities as appropriate.
  • Monitor systems associated with the logistics buildings and tank farm and maintain KPIs to ensure proper operation and compliance with internal and external requirements.
  • Act as the single point of contact for logistics building and tank farm compliance activities, including deviations, change controls, and CAPAs, in partnership with Operations, Quality Control, Process Engineering, Supply Chain, HSE, and Quality Assurance.
  • Collaborate within the FUME organization to implement efficient and effective maintenance and reliability practices aligned with global engineering standards.
  • Apply hands‑on problem‑solving skills to quickly resolve equipment failures, troubleshoot issues, lead root cause analysis (RCA) investigations, and guide operations personnel through system issue resolution.
  • Provide internal customer consultation and notifications for issues involving critical utilities and equipment associated with the logistics buildings and tank farm.
  • Ensure corrective and preventive maintenance items are identified in the appropriate tracking systems and completed by required due dates.
  • Provide technical support to FUME, HSE, Process Engineering, Supply Chain, Quality Control, and other partner functions as needed.
  • Support internal and external inspections and investigations, including quality and HSE‑related activities.
  • Maintain clear and effective communication with appropriate customer groups.
Basic Requirements
  • Bachelor’s degree in Engineering; Mechanical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ering Technology, or Chemical Engineering preferred.
  • 5+ years of direct engineering experience with building, utility, tank farm, and logistics‑related systems in an FDA‑regulated industry.
  • Qualified applicants must be authorized to work in the United States on a full‑time basis. Lilly will not provide support for or sponsor work authorization or visas for this role, including but not limited to F‑1 CPT, F‑1 OPT, F‑1 STEM OPT, J‑1, H‑1B, TN, O‑1, E‑3, H‑1B1, or L‑1.
Additional Preferences
  • Previous start‑up experience for new buildings and pharmaceutical equipment‑related systems.
  • Understanding of agile engineering techniques used to manage buildings, utilities, and equipment.
  • Previous experience with equipment installation, commissioning, and qualification.
  • Engineering experience with manufacturing or chemical plant utilities.
  • Engineering‑related project management experience.
  • Experience with CMMS (Computerized Maintenance Management Systems), UBMS (Utility Building Management System), and QBMS (Quality Building Management System).
  • Strong office software skills, including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ook, UMS, data historian tools, and collaboration sites.
  • Excellent interpersonal, written, and verbal communication skills.
  • Knowledge of cGMP principles.
  • Demonstrated understanding of engineering concepts, first principles, and engineering functional standards.
  • Strong technical aptitude with the ability to train and mentor others.
